NANO Nuclear: Company Overview
NANO Nuclear Energy Inc. is poised to become a leader in the nuclear energy sector, aiming to innovate within five primary business lines. These include portable microreactor technologies, nuclear fuel fabrication, transportation, consulting services, and exploring nuclear applications for space. Given this diverse approach, the company is quickly establishing itself as a pioneer in the nuclear technology industry.
Innovative Reactor Technologies
The company’s dedication to innovation is evident through several key projects currently under development. The KRONOS MMR™ Energy System signifies a pivotal advancement, featuring a stationary high-temperature gas-cooled reactor. Collaborations with educational institutions, such as the University of Illinois Urbana-Champaign, underscore NANO Nuclear’s commitment to research and practical application.
Future Directions and Strategic Partnerships
Furthermore, strategic subsidiaries like Advanced Fuel Transportation Inc. (AFT) and HALEU Energy Fuel Inc. (HEF) emphasize the company's focus on creating a reliable supply chain within the nuclear sector. AFT aims to facilitate the distribution of high-assay low-enriched uranium (HALEU) fuel, crucial for powering small modular reactors and enhancing the operational capabilities of nuclear technology across North America.
